It's quite a challenge to add that hover effect with the overlay image properly. Here's how I did it, in case you wanna see other way to do it:

HTML

<img src="images/image-equilibrium.jpg" alt="Equilibrium" class="pic">
  <div class="icon">
    <img src="images/icon-view.svg" alt="icon-view" class="icon-view">
  </div>

CSS

.pic {
   width: 300px;
   background: url('images/icon-view.svg') center center no-repeat;
   background-color: $Cyan-hover;
   background-size: cover;
   margin: auto;
   border-radius: 10px;
}
.icon {
   display: grid;
   justify-content: center;
   align-items: center;
   position: absolute;
   opacity: 0;
   background-color: $Cyan-hover;
   width: 300px;
   height: 300px;
   border-radius: 10px;
}
icon:hover {
   opacity: .5;
   cursor: pointer;
}

Just don't forget to change the class names to match yours.
